Since I bought the bike, the front brake was barely working. Even after changing the fluid, the lever feel didn’t improve, and on top of that, fluid was seeping from the reservoir — a hopeless situation.
I decided to go ahead and do a full overhaul.
Getting the pistons out was an absolute struggle.
Even using a piston removal tool on the caliper by itself, they wouldn’t budge at all.
I finally got them out by using the hydraulic pressure of the brake system itself.
I think the seals and pistons may have fused together.

Installed new pistons and reassembled everything.
The seals were so thin that assembly was tricky, and it took quite a bit of time.

I also overhauled the master cylinder side, and the reassembly was completed successfully.
